Sat 748418272402260

decimal
149683.3272402260
degree
0°149683′499″3272402260‴
percentile
35.63896539169145%
name
inxfokqpmpx
cycle
0
epoch
0
period
74
block
149683
offset
3272402260
timestamp
rarity
common
inscriptions
location
66fb166db64952e76f0dd191f6e24347d9ba34f56d0013bb246e2d800089c2a7:0:0
address
bc1p9n2dud4x3qp3pk7t7sygnltudtx29g7k04wju766rqh6j96mfnxqg6va4d